Definitions:

Bottom-Up Approach

A strategy that starts at the very detailed level and works upwards to form a complete picture, often used in analysis or planning.

Operating Cash Flow

Operating cash flow is the cash that comes from a company's usual business activities, showing if it can produce enough positive cash flow to sustain and expand its operations.

EBIT

Earnings Before Interest and Taxes, a measure of a firm's profit that includes all income and expenses except interest and income tax expenses.

Straight-Line Depreciation

A method of allocating the cost of a fixed asset evenly across its useful life.
